Knowledge
(Described as Theoritical and/or Factual Knowledge.)
|
1) Understands the importance of management and organization in the organization providing mass nutrition services, learns the managerial role of the dietitian and improves knowledge and skills in this regard.
|
Skills
(Describe as Cognitive and/or Practical Skills.)
|
1) Observes the processes of mass feeding systems and interprets them with existing theoretical knowledge.
|
2) Gains the ability to see the problems encountered in mass feeding systems, analyze them, solve problems and make decisions.
|
Competences
(Described as "Ability of the learner to apply knowledge and skills autonomously with responsibility", "Learning to learn"," Communication and social" and "Field specific" competences.)
|
1) Learns menu planning applications for the target group served.
|
2) Observes and interprets the processes of mass feeding systems in terms of food safety.
